Niala, a beautiful and ageless priestess of Gaea (Earth), is caught in monumental battles between Love and War, between the desire to be mortal and the dawning knowledge she is not.

Najahmara lived in peace for over 300 years, hidden away in a quiet valley…

Ruth SoutherRuth Souther, the author

Ruth Souther has been writing fiction for over twenty-five years, with much of that time spent working with mythology. Those stories translated into a personal growth experience which led to the first novel in a fantasy series based on the Greek myths. During one intense year of research on the ancient gods and goddesses, in walked the inspiration for Immortal Journey in the form of Aphrodite, and her consort, Ares.
